我正在寻找一套插件,可以帮助我最终切换到vim全职.
现在我正在使用Komodo取得了一些成功,但他们的vim绑定有足够的错误,我已经厌倦了它.
不过,我在Komodo所喜欢的是代码完成.所以,这就是我正在寻找的(按重要性排序).
代码完成,意思是:编写完整模块/功能/等的能力.在python路径上的任何模块中,而不仅仅是系统模块.完成时显示文档字符串的奖励积分.
跳转到类定义.我猜CTAGS会这样做,所以你们如何管理自动更新你的标签文件?
用于管理缓冲区的项目类型管理:理想情况下,可以在目录结构中grep文件名以打开它.在缓冲区打开时显示类定义索引的奖励.
Bzr整合.不是非常重要,因为大部分内容我都可以放到shell中去做.
rslite.. 17
在这里你可以找到一些关于这个的信息.
它涵盖了代码完成,在打开的文件中包含类和函数列表.我没有为vim做一个完整的配置,因为我主要不使用Python,但我对在更好的Python IDE中转换vim有相同的兴趣.
编辑:原始站点已关闭,因此发现它保存在Web存档中.
在这里你可以找到一些关于这个的信息.
它涵盖了代码完成,在打开的文件中包含类和函数列表.我没有为vim做一个完整的配置,因为我主要不使用Python,但我对在更好的Python IDE中转换vim有相同的兴趣.
编辑:原始站点已关闭,因此发现它保存在Web存档中.